Reasons For Blueberry Chlorosis – Tips On Blueberry Chlorosis Treatment
Chlorosis in blueberry plants occurs when a lack of iron prevents the leaves from producing chlorophyll. In other words, the soil is too alkaline for healthy growth of blueberries., and chlorosis occurs when a high pH level binds up the iron in the soil.
